As you have also mentioned, DR or DA is just estimation of one of the many factors for ranking, so finding all-satisfactory relativeness in DA/DR and organic ranking is hardly possible before and after the update, Only assumptions and opinions can be shared about it but can't be proved with sufficient data. Moz, ahrefs etc. are trying to replicate how Google calculates the worth of a page and domain but they are far away from the actual estimation as they lack in all points like crawling resources, scale, data handling/processing etc. So these tools don't know the web of the links as Google know, even if they have tried to replicate all the guidelines and information Google has yet disclosed about calculating the worth through backlinks.The dialog is around how much it even matters after the update.
